رسالة الخطأ التي قدمتها، "LVE load fail: could not insert 'module': Cannot allocate memory" تشير إلى وجود مشكلة تتعلق بتخصيص الذاكرة أثناء محاولة تحميل وحدة "module".
إليك بعض الخطوات التي يمكنك اتباعها لاستكشاف هذه المشكلة وحلها:
تحقق من استخدام الذاكرة في النظام:
- تحقق من استخدام الذاكرة الحالية على نظامك باستخدام أمر مثل
free -m
أوtop
. سيعطيك هذا فكرة عن مقدار الذاكرة المستخدمة حاليًا وكمية الذاكرة المتاحة.
تحقق من التبعيات الخاصة بالوحدة:
- تأكد من أن جميع التبعيات المطلوبة للوحدة "module" تم تثبيتها بشكل صحيح ومهيئة.
تحقق من إصدار النواة:
- تأكد من أن إصدار النواة الذي تستخدمه متوافق مع الوحدة "module".
إعادة تشغيل النظام:
- في بعض الأحيان، يمكن حل مشكلات الذاكرة ببساطة عن طريق إعادة تشغيل النظام.
زيادة مساحة التبادل (Swap):
- إذا كان نظامك يعاني من نقص في الذاكرة الفعلية، قد تفكر في زيادة مساحة التبادل (Swap). هذه جزء من القرص الصلب يُستخدم كذاكرة افتراضية عندما تكون الذاكرة الفعلية ممتلئة.
تحقق من وجود مشاكل في الأجهزة:
- من الممكن أن تكون هناك مشكلة في الأجهزة تتسبب في مشاكل تخصيص الذاكرة. قد ترغب في تشغيل تشخيصات الأجهزة للتحقق من وجود أي مشاكل.
تحقق من السجلات:
- تحقق من سجلات النظام (
/var/log/messages
,/var/log/syslog
, إلخ) للحصول على مزيد من المعلومات أو رسائل خطأ إضافية تتعلق بوحدة "module".
الاتصال بالدعم:
- إذا كنت غير قادر على حل المشكلة بنفسك، قد يكون من الأفضل التواصل مع قنوات الدعم الخاصة بالبرنامج أو الوحدة التي تعمل معها. قد يكون لديهم توصيات أو إصلاحات محددة لهذه المشكلة.
تذكر أن تتوخى الحذر، خاصة عند إجراء تغييرات تتعلق بالذاكرة في النظام والوحدات الخاصة بالنواة، لأنها يمكن أن تؤثر بشكل كبير على استقرار النظام وأدائه. دائمًا قم بعمل نسخ احتياطية للبيانات الهامة والإعدادات قبل إجراء أي تغييرات كبيرة.